Java数据库连接JDBC学习教案
本文档是关于Java数据库连接JDBC的学习教案,总共38页,涵盖了数据库管理系统、SQL语言、ODBC、JDBC等基础知识,并提供了详细的实践指导。
数据库管理系统(Database Management System)
数据库管理系统是一种操纵和管理数据库的大型软件,是用于建立、使用和维护数据库的。其主要用途是科学地组织和存储数据,并高效地获取和维护数据。常见的数据库管理系统有Microsoft Access、Oracle、Microsoft SQL Server、Visual FoxPro等。
SQL语言
SQL语言,全称为Structured Query Language,是一种用于管理关系数据库的标准语言。SQL语言的优点是结构简洁、功能强大、简单易学。SQL语言的地位犹如英语在世界上的地位,是数据库系统的通用语言。
ODBC(Open Database Connectivity)
ODBC是开放数据库互连的缩写,是微软开放服务结构中有关数据库的一个组成部分。ODBC的最大优点是能以统一的方式处理所有的数据库,不依赖任何DBMS,不直接与DBMS打交道,所有的数据库操作由对应DBMS的ODBC驱动程序完成。
JDBC(Java Database Connectivity)
JDBC是Java数据库连接的缩写,是一种用于执行SQL语句的Java API。JDBC由一组用Java语言编写的类和接口组成,可以为多种关系数据库提供统一访问。JDBC的通用性是其最大优点,只需用JDBC API编写一个程序,就可以向相应数据库发送SQL语句,进而访问多种不同的数据库。
JDBC的三大功能
JDBC可以完成三件事:与一个数据库建立连接、向数据库发送SQL语句、处理数据库返回的结果。JDBC可以创建一个数据库,创建一个ODBC数据源,同数据库建立连接,然后建立一个JDBC-ODBC桥接器,最后创建Connection对象,连接到数据库。
创建数据源
创建数据源是使用JDBC连接数据库的第一步。首先,创建一个数据库,例如使用Access创建一个数据库student.mdb,然后创建一个ODBC数据源,同数据库建立连接。最后,使用JDBC API连接到数据库。